Steven Feldman is new TVI Pacific VP for Investor, Corporate Relations

Editor April 28, 2013
TVI-Pacific

MANILA (Mindanao Examiner / Apr. 28, 2013) – TVI Pacific Inc. announced the appointment of Steven Feldman to the position of Vice President, Investor and Corporate Relations, effective April 26.

TVI said Feldman will lead the investor relations and external communications functions for the company and will be the primary liaison between TVI and investors, analysts and the financial community.

“Steven brings experience and intensity to his new position at TVI. We look forward to him playing an important role in communicating our current operations and growth initiatives to expand and contribute to shareholder value as a diversified mining company focused on Southeast Asia.”

“This is truly an exciting time for TVI as we advance our Balabag gold-silver project towards production in 2014 and forge ahead with our Mindoro joint venture projects that represent near and mid-term cash flow opportunities,” said Clifford M. James, Chairman and CEO of TVI Pacific.

He said Feldman has significant experience in the mining industry, adding prior to joining TVI, he was manager for Investor Relations from 2005 to 2012 at SouthGobi Resources Ltd. which is the largest foreign operator in Mongolia’s coal sector.

Feldman served as the key contact and spokesperson for SouthGobi in North America where he attended and presented at major industry conferences.
